Storybook farmhouse on a private 5.5-acre setting. Originally built in 1901 and moved to this property in 2000 when it was updated with a new foundation, plumbing, electrical and insulation. The 2,010 sq ft home blends vintage charm with modern comfort. Old growth wood floors, historical light fixtures, wood-wrapped windows. The generous sized bath has a claw-foot tub with separate shower. The cabinets in the bath were reclaimed from a home in Edison built in the 1880's. Primary bedroom on main floor with huge walk-in closet hidden behind the stained glass door. Amazing kitchen with cherry cabinetry, soft closing drawers and tons of counterspace. Walk in Pantry and utility room. Separate guest house with ¾ bath. More history, this building used to be the train station scale house in Burlington. Great flexibility for guests, studio or rental use. Large Garden space gets tons of sun.Canning shed and cellar to store your bounty. Property is wooded for wonderful privacy, yet cleared enough for sunlight. Across the road is the “work side” of the property with a 72x30 shop, machine shed, multiple outbuildings, and 2 RV spaces with hookups. Underground power and water to shop. Also a 1/2 bath, plumbed for shower in shop. Ideal for storage, equipment, hobbies, business use or possible income opportunities—all tucked far enough away that you don’t have to admire the shop view from the house.
